About 8 Leadenhall Street
8 Leadenhall Street is a mid-terrace house in Halifax (HX1 3PE). It has a recorded floor area of 70 m² (around 753 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(May 2021) shows an E (score 54),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. When first surveyed in March 2021 the rating was G,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 88),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.
At 70 m² the property is well over the postcode median (36 m² across 10 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ock.
